dwarfdump: -summarize-types: print a short summary (unqualified type name, hash, length) of type units rather than dumping contents

This is just a quick utility handy for getting rough summaries of types
in a given object or dwo file. I've been using it to investigate the
amount of type info redundancy across a project build, for example.
